Recently, Miss Bao Ngoc officially spoke out about the letter of admission to the Master's program at Columbia University (USA).
The beauty affirmed that the admission letter below is a document issued by Columbia University and the content related to the school, training program, and admission results has no changes compared to the original documents.
In addition, she explained that some information in the successful letter was hidden to protect personal privacy.
The way images are presented after processing has led to concerns and questions. Bao Ngoc acknowledges these opinions and realizes that this is something that needs to be done more carefully," she added.

The representative of Vietnam at the Miss World 2026 contest has arranged to start studying for a Master's program at Columbia University from May 2027.
Miss Bao Ngoc attracted attention when announcing her admission letter for the Master's program in Public Management in Science and Environmental Policy at Columbia University (USA).
Besides the compliments and congratulations to her, many netizens discovered that the letter Bao Ngoc shared contained many unusual errors for a document believed to be from the leading university in the United States. Some people pointed out English spelling errors, even suspecting that this was a "fake invitation letter".
Notably, the detail that was once understood as a "full scholarship" was later said to be just a tuition fee support of 15,000 USD.
Miss Le Nguyen Bao Ngoc, born in 2001, is the representative of Vietnam to participate in the 73rd Miss World (Miss World) contest held in Vietnam.
The final night is scheduled to take place on September 5, 2026 in Nha Trang city, Khanh Hoa province.
With an outstanding height of 1.86m, good English proficiency (IELTS 8.0) and experience in winning Miss Intercontinental 2022, Bao Ngoc is expected to win a high position in the biggest beauty arena on this planet.
